#1d6db1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d6db1 is composed of 11.4% red, 42.7%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.6%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 207.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 40.4%. #1d6db1 color hex could be obtained by blending #3adaff with #000063.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#1d6db1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d6db1 has RGB values of R:29, G:109, B:177 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 1928625.

Shades and Tints of #1d6db1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010508 is the darkest color, while #f7f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d6db1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#64676a is the less saturated color, while #056fc9 is the most saturated one.
